柯林斯词典
- N-COUNT 运河;水道;沟渠
Acanalis a long, narrow stretch of water that has been made for boats to travel along or to bring water to a particular area.- ...the Grand Union Canal.
大联盟运河 - ...Venetian canals and bridges.
威尼斯水道和桥梁
- ...the Grand Union Canal.
- N-COUNT (人体内输送食物、空气等的)管,道
Acanalis a narrow tube inside your body for carrying food, air, or other substances.- ...delaying the food's progress through the alimentary canal.
延缓食物通过消化道
